Civic group working to boost quality of life

Scranton is an interesting place. It has for years been considered the quintessential has-been: once an industrial giant, the capital of the anthracite coal industry, then a significant center of clothing manufacturing and on to a place that had no particular industrial strength. It became a “rust belt” shrinking city in a shrinking part of the country. But the image doesn’t really hold up. Noteworthy New Releases for Children and Teens: December 2020

Melissa de la Cruz. Roaring Brook, Dec. 1 $16.99 (336p) ISBN 978-1-250-31121-4. Ages 10–14. In the first book in Cruz’s The Chronicles of Never After fantasy series, Filomena Jefferson-Cho, 12, is a huge fan of epic fairy tale mash-up series Never After, and she’s anticipating the release of the 13th and final volume—until she learns that the long-deceased author apparently never wrote it.
